Equipping Your Team: Vital Fire Safety Protocols

A well-trained workforce is a safe workforce. Implementing comprehensive fire safety training programs empowers your employees to spot potential hazards and respond effectively in case of an emergency. This crucial step not only safeguards lives but also minimizes property damage and interruptions to business operations. Fire safety training should cover a range of essential topics, including:

  • Recognizing different types of fires
  • Operating fire extinguishers correctly
  • Developing evacuation plans and procedures
  • Grasping fire safety codes and regulations
  • Engaging in regular fire drills

By offering this training, you demonstrate your commitment to employee well-being and create a culture of safety within your organization.

Proactive Fire Prevention

Fire safety shouldn't be a reactive response to emergencies; instead, it should be embraced proactive measures that minimize risks and protect lives. A comprehensive fire prevention plan encompasses several key components. First, inspect periodically all fire safety equipment like alarms, sprinklers, and extinguishers. Second, create a well-defined evacuation plan that are regularly practiced to ensure everyone knows what to do in an emergency. Third, discourage smoking in unauthorized areas and provide proper ventilation to reduce the risk of flammable materials ignition. Finally, train employees and residents about fire hazards, safe practices, and emergency protocols through informative sessions.

By taking these proactive steps, communities can significantly lower the risk of fires and create a safer environment for all.
